Maliha Noorani teaches art history at The National College of Arts in Lahore and works closely with museums and cultural institutions. After her BFA, she read art history at SOAS and Yale. She was a curatorial fellow at the Arthur M. Sackler Museum, Harvard Art Museums. Her most recent projects include curating Taxila Museum’s first special exhibit, Gandhara: Routes and Roots, 2022 and co-curator of the project exhibit Crafting Histories, 2023 (Glasgow Life Museums x National College of Arts).
